We're joined in this episode by Hester Wells, the only guest we've ever had who has her own biographical comic that she didn't draw herself (specificity, yo), to help us out with the thorny topic of objectification, particularly in mainstream comics.
This episode is groaning with comics, throbbing with intellectual discussion and glistening with salty language.
